The Importance of Communication
One of the cornerstones of a thriving sexual relationship is open and honest communication. Dr. Laura Berman, a renowned sex therapist and author, emphasizes, "Communication is the foundation of intimacy. Without it, you cannot explore desires and boundaries effectively."
Tips for Effective Communication:
- Create a Safe Space: Ensure that both partners feel comfortable sharing their thoughts without judgment.
- Be Specific: Instead of vague notions like “I want more,” try “I’d love to explore new positions."
- Use "I" Statements: This minimizes defensiveness. For example, “I feel vulnerable when…” is less accusatory than “You never…”
Emotional Connection and Intimacy
Emotional intimacy is a critical factor in sexual satisfaction. According to a study published in the Journal of Sex Research, couples who feel emotionally connected tend to enjoy more fulfilling sexual experiences.
Building Emotional Intimacy:
- Schedule Regular Date Nights: Intentionally setting time aside for each other strengthens your bond.
- Engage in Deep Conversations: Discuss dreams, fears, and aspirations to create a shared emotional landscape.
- Practice Appreciation: Regularly express gratitude for each other, reinforcing your positive feelings.
The Science of Sexual Desire
Understanding Sexual Response Cycles
Dr. Helen Fisher, a biological anthropologist and human attraction expert, states that understanding sexual response cycles can profoundly alter sexual experiences. The model typically includes four phases: excitement, plateau, orgasm, and resolution. Each phase can be mutually navigated to enhance satisfaction.
Factors Influencing Desire
-
Hormonal Fluctuations: Men and women experience shifts in sexual desire due to hormonal changes. Understanding these fluctuations can provide insight into timing sexual experiences.
-
Mental Health: Stress and anxiety can significantly diminish libido. Methods for improvement include mindfulness practices and seeking therapy if necessary.
- Physical Health: Maintaining a healthy lifestyle through diet, exercise, and adequate sleep also fosters higher levels of sexual desire.

The Power of Foreplay
Foreplay should never be an afterthought. It is vital in building arousal and emotional closeness. Experts suggest that extended foreplay can lead to heightened sexual pleasure for women, as traditional sexual scripts may overlook their unique physiological responses.
Tips for Exciting Foreplay:
- Explore Each Other’s Bodies: Use hands, lips, and tongue to explore various erogenous zones.
- Whisper Fantasies: Creating a verbal connection can ramp up arousal levels.
- Take Your Time: There’s no rush; savor each moment.

The Role of Aftercare
Aftercare refers to the emotional and physical support provided to a partner post-intimacy. This practice is particularly relevant when engaging in more intense sexual activities, like BDSM.
Dr. Lila K. M. Green, a certified sex therapist, advises that “aftercare isn’t just a luxury – it’s a necessity for fostering trust and providing emotional closure.” It can include cuddling, gentle conversation, or simply a shared moment of quiet reflection.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. How can I talk to my partner about my sexual desires?
Open communication is fundamental. Choose a comfortable setting and express your feelings using "I" statements.
2. Is it normal for sexual desire to fluctuate over time?
Absolutely! Various factors such as stress, health, and life changes can impact sexual desire.
3. Are sex toys necessary for a fulfilling sexual relationship?
No, they are not necessary, but they can enhance pleasure and exploration. It ultimately depends on personal preferences.
4. How can we keep things exciting in long-term relationships?
Variation in sexual activities, exploring fantasies, and regularly checking in with each other can keep your intimate life fresh and exciting.
5. What should I do if my partner and I have mismatched libidos?
Open dialogue is crucial. Discussing expectations and finding middle ground can ensure both partners feel satisfied.
